Threshold Cryptosystem and Its Application in Subliminal Channel Scheme

摘要

This paper analyzed the basic principles of secret sharing in threshold cryptosystem and its superiority for application in subliminal channel schemes. Considering the security threats and system flaws of present subliminal channel schemes, we present a threshold subliminal channel scheme based on ECC (Elliptic Curve Cryptosystem). By utilizing secret key sharing the scheme achieves threshold management of subliminal message generating and recovering; the subliminal message can only be generated and recovered by no less than t valid members. The identity blinding and probabilistic encryption algorithms enable the protocol parties to be anonymous for secrecy protection and the anonymity can also be revoked conveniently if necessary. The threshold tracing algorithm ensures the identity tracing right can only be executed by no less than t valid members. The scheme renders effective supervision on subliminal message and identity secrecy. The application case of the subliminal channel scheme further justifies its brevity, security, high efficiency regarding its application in software and hardware environment.
